Shadow Warrior 2 Delayed To October

It was announced last month that Shadow Warrior 2 would be coming to PC first and releasing in September with consoles to follow later in the year. It appears that target was overly aggressive, though, as Devolver Digital has now sent out that Shadow Warrior 2 will be releasing October 13th on PC and delayed to 2017 on Xbox One and PlayStation 4.

Playing as Lo Wang, you are a mercenary in the remade world of Shadow Warrior, which was one of the most successful remakes of 2013, bringing the original 1997 game into the modern era. Shadow Warrior 2 takes the action from the remake with the first-person shooter guns and blades and makes it bigger. It brings four player co-op so that you can play the campaign with your friends, either on the primary missions or the side quests. The environments are designed to be a big, open vertically scalable world utilizing procedurally generated environments to help make the game feel different each time through.

Shadow Warrior Verticality

That's not the only thing that is procedurally generated either. Loot, while featuring a wide variety of weapons with upgrades, is procedurally generated as well, in the style of Action RPGs like Diablo. Weapons can have up to three stones in them to upgrade things from general performance to elemental effects and more, all feeding into the damage system they have, which features dynamic dismemberment as you have the ability to carve enemies apart or blow giant holes through them.
